Noah, his family, and the animals got on the ark, watched God close the door, and waited. The storm lasted forty days and nights, but that was only the beginning. In total, they all stayed on that boat for one year and ten days before the land was dry enough for them to get off. Can you imagine the noise? The smell? The shoveling? This was a serious invasion of everyone’s personal space bubbles!
Have you ever had to wait on God? Maybe you followed his lead, but your life feels flooded with trouble right now. Maybe you have some relationships that make you desperate for a little elbow room. Maybe the view from your window is a raging storm.
Genesis 8:1 says, “But God remembered Noah and all the beast and all the livestock that were with him in the ark.” Hold tight to the promise that God remembers you, too. Very soon, he will open the door and invite you to step into the sunshine.

From Genesis to Revelation, “God’s Redemption Story” outlines the narrative of God’s plan for the reconciliation of humanity. This 12-part reading plan summarizes the story of the Bible. // Genesis begins with God creating the world and for His children to be in relationship with Him. Sin separated humanity from their loving Father. Genesis starts the story of the Father’s master plan to sacrifice his Son to redeem His children.
